Raghurama Rajan key comments on Andhra Pradesh ‘Loan crisis’

No economic and political lover in India would forget the former Governor of Reserve Bank of India, Raghu Ram Rajan. He has been praised all over the country for his commendable efforts as the RBI governor but he left the office as soon as the Modi Government came into force in India. Now, he has been into teaching but often comments on the Indian economic situation without any hesitation.

Commenting on the demands that have been coming out from all parts of the country about the extension of the Moratorium on loans, Rajan said that this culture has to be stopped and clarified that he has been in senses to make this confident statement about ‘this moratorium process shouldn’t be extended’.

In that order, he also commented on Andhra Pradesh’s microfinance crisis. While commenting on this Moratorium on loans, he cited the AP’s micro Finance crisis as a very good example that can actually support his statement. Rajan reminded that after the government assures people once that there is no need to pay money… they are definitely not going to save money which the people don’t realize the trick.

“This makes it difficult for them to repay the loan and then it becomes difficult to make a habit of bringing back payments. This is also the reason for the microfinance crisis that has plagued AP in the past. Microfinance institutions are weakened because of this. If a moratorium is imposed for a long time, it will be difficult for the banks to recover the amount,” Rajan said.

Finally, Rajan said that though Covid is increasing at an unexplainable level, RBI has done a very good job and the rupee value hasn’t been too low and asserted it as the welcome part in this entire episode.
